CNSA has released an image of Tianwen-2 in deep space using a robotic arm, giving us a proper look at the spacecraft and return capsule for delivering samples from near Earth asteroid 469219 Kamoʻoalewa. Tianwen-2 has been in space for 125 days, is 45 million km from Kamoʻoalewa.

Deep Blue Nebula has carried out a 308-second static fire test of the second stage of its Nebula-1 launcher as a step towards a first orbital flight. No tentative month for launch given. mp.weixin.qq.com/s/H7X2JnaAsi...

JAXA's Hiroshi Yamakawa says MMX Phobos sample return mission almost ready, undergoing final testing. Launch in 2026, return to Earth with samples of the Martian moon in 2031. #IAC2025

V. Narayanan says ISRO targeting early 2027 for Gaganyaan crewed mission. #IAC2025

ISRO's V. Narayanan says at #IAC2025 that the agency has received approval for the LUPEX lunar landing mission with JAXA.

Launch 59: A Long March 2D lifted off at 0300 UTC today from Xichang, sending the experimental Shiyan-30 (01) and (02) satellites into orbit. mp.weixin.qq.com/s/eOGi0svYbp...

And here's launch 58: A Long March 6A lifted off at 1240 UTC today from Taiyuan, sending 5 Guowang broadband satellites into orbit.

A Long March 4C lifted off at 1928 UTC on Sept. 26 from Jiuquan, successfully sending the Fengyun-3 (08) meteorological satellite into orbit. This was China's 57th launch of 2025.
